WebDracaena fragrans deremensis “Warneckei” 0 out of 5 (0) Care. Water when the top layer of soil is 1-2 inches dry. Touch soil with fingers to check if soil is dry. Always give room temperate water. Yellow leaves are indication of under watering and Brown edges of a green leaf indicate overwatering.

Web19 aug. 2024 · The sight of leaves falling off a dracaena plant is not always an indication of impending death. It is normal for the older leaves on a plant to fall off as the plant develops; this is to give room for new growth. In this case, the lowest leaves will usually turn yellow first before dropping from the plant.
